Freshwater Clam (Corbicula fluminea)Overview
The Freshwater Clam (Corbicula fluminea) is a compact, rounded bivalve known for its smooth shell and natural ability to filter aquarium water. It improves water clarity by removing suspended particles and microorganisms, making it a popular choice for established aquariums. Best suited for stable, mature tanks with gentle fish.
OriginNative to East and Southeast Asia, occupying slow-moving rivers, streams, and lakes with sandy or fine gravel substrates.
FeedingA true filter feeder that consumes:
- Microalgae
- Infusoria
- Phytoplankton
- Fine suspended detritus
In very clean or newly established aquariums, supplemental feeding with phytoplankton or micronized invertebrate foods may be required.
Tank MatesPeaceful and suitable for calm community tanks with:
- Tetras & rasboras
- Small gouramis
- Corydoras
- Cherry shrimp and other peaceful inverts
- Snails
Avoid: Loaches, puffers, crayfish, crabs, and large cichlids that may disturb or damage clams.
AggressionNone. Completely passive and typically remains partially buried in the substrate.
Experience LevelIntermediate. While hardy once established, they require:
- Mature tanks with stable micro-food levels
- Excellent water quality
- Fine sand or soft gravel for burrowing
Most issues arise from starvation or poor water conditions.
Water Parameters- Temperature: 70–80°F (21–27°C)
- pH: 6.8–8.0
- Hardness: 6–18 dGH
-
Notes:
- Very sensitive to ammonia and nitrite.
- Avoid strong currents and sharp substrates.
- Works best in calm, established aquariums.
The Freshwater Clam (Corbicula fluminea) is a peaceful, low-maintenance filter feeder that enhances water clarity and fits well in mature community setups with gentle tank mates.
